I don't think those odds are correct on the pdf. Respectfully, I also think the other calculations in this thread are off.

Assuming even distribution for hobby & jumbo, for an insert set like the Rookie Roundball Remnants Foilfractor, there are 20 total cards. So, even distribution would be 10 in hobby & 10 in jumbo.

Hobby: 10 cards x 246000 = 2,460,000 packs

2,460,000 packs / 20 packs in hobby box = 123,000 hobby boxes

Jumbo: 10 cards x 62785 = 627,850 packs

627,785 packs / 10 packs in jumbo box = 62,785 jumbo boxes

It's probably not exact, so you can play around with the other foilfractor insert sets to get an idea of print run ranges.

Math time with Uncle Bob.

Using the "THE DAILY DRIBBLE" insert which is Hobby only, the Foilfractor 1/1 odds, and the assumption that the Hobby box makeup is identical to MLB Topps Hobby of 20 packs per box:

THE DOUBLE DRIBBLE checklist: 40
THE DOUBLE DRIBBLE Foilfractor odds: 1:133,934
Packs per Hobby Box: 20
Hobby Boxes made: 267,868


For funsies, here is the same insert math for Jumbo boxes:
THE DOUBLE DRIBBLE checklist: 40
THE DOUBLE DRIBBLE Foilfractor odds: 1:33706
Packs per Jumbo Box: 10
Jumbo Boxes made: 134,824


These are the only SKU's THE DAILY DRIBBLE INSERT is in so do what you will with these box numbers.

Not sure but total Pop graded for Stephen Curry:

BGS- 2600
PSA- 5600

So if that's about 50% graded you can figure on about 16.5K total

Topps Chrome is /999 with 575 graded between PSA & BGS for Stephen Curry


If you want to compare numbers I would lean towards 2003-04 Lebron Rookie year assuming this was the largest print run of the Topps era for base. Guessing here.....

03-04 Lebron Topps RC is around 16K graded between BGS & PSA. So maybe 30K total? This doesn't include 1st Editions which is probably another 1.5K produced. Spit balling here but you get the idea of the massive difference
